Table 3 Bioassay results with diflubenzuron in genome-modified Drosophila.

From: Striking diflubenzuron resistance in Culex pipiens, the prime vector of West Nile Virus

Strain

LC50 in ppm (95% CL)

Resistance Ratio (95% CL)

nos.Cas9

0.34 (0.31–0.37)

1

Dif4 (I1056L)

7.52 (6.73–8.19)

22.1 (19.7–24.5)

Px39 (I1056M)

>1,000

>2,941

  1. LC50 values (in ppm, mg/L) for diflubenzuron are shown for the control flies (nos.Cas9) and the genome modified flies Dif4 (I1056L) and Px39 (I1056M) with the respective 95% confidence limits. The resistance ratio is calculated over the control flies.
